Skip to content

Commit ac56b87

Browse files
committed
Preparing for the 3.3.0.beta.1 release
1 parent 4f58d4c commit ac56b87

File tree

4 files changed

+25
-2
lines changed

4 files changed

+25
-2
lines changed

Changelog.md

Lines changed: 11 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1,3 +1,14 @@
1+
## 3.3.0.beta.1
2+
3+
*New features:*
4+
- Better checks for color spaces in clr files
5+
6+
*Fixed issues:*
7+
- Validating images from nibs now respects bundle
8+
9+
*Other:*
10+
- We now use swift package manager as our build tool
11+
112
## 3.2.0
213

314
New features:

R.swift.podspec

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,7 +1,7 @@
11
Pod::Spec.new do |spec|
22

33
spec.name = "R.swift"
4-
spec.version = "3.2.0"
4+
spec.version = "3.3.0.beta.1"
55
spec.license = "MIT"
66

77
spec.summary = "Get strong typed, autocompleted resources like images, fonts and segues in Swift projects"

ResourceApp/ResourceApp.xcodeproj/project.pbxproj

Lines changed: 12 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-9,6 +9,8 @@
99
/* Begin PBXBuildFile section */
1010
5D1AFAB11C858637003FE7AB /* Localizable.strings in Resources */ = {isa = PBXBuildFile; fileRef = 5D1AFAAF1C858637003FE7AB /* Localizable.strings */; };
1111
5D9E41341C96918E002172D3 /* StringsTests.swift in Sources */ = {isa = PBXBuildFile; fileRef = 5D9E41331C96918E002172D3 /* StringsTests.swift */; };
12+
8A0FBCE6E8FF0950B8821B0B /* Pods_Shared_ResourceApp_tvOS.framework in Frameworks */ = {isa = PBXBuildFile; fileRef = EF513940333862726B930435 /* Pods_Shared_ResourceApp_tvOS.framework */; };
13+
B9AD30832913E120484BAD10 /* Pods_Shared_ResourceAppTests.framework in Frameworks */ = {isa = PBXBuildFile; fileRef = E1B2B4287A3B52DAB3098AA2 /* Pods_Shared_ResourceAppTests.framework */; };
1214
C378DD7A1C68C2BF003598B8 /* SupplementaryElement.xib in Resources */ = {isa = PBXBuildFile; fileRef = C378DD791C68C2BF003598B8 /* SupplementaryElement.xib */; };
1315
D50175BE1B5FEFD000DB8314 /* Secondary.storyboard in Resources */ = {isa = PBXBuildFile; fileRef = D50175BC1B5FEFD000DB8314 /* Secondary.storyboard */; };
1416
D5159E9E1BBC33680013F52A /* [email protected] in Resources */ = {isa = PBXBuildFile; fileRef = D5159E9D1BBC33680013F52A /* [email protected] */; };
@@ -60,6 +62,7 @@
6062
D5F05D461BB52078003AE55E /* duplicateJson in Resources */ = {isa = PBXBuildFile; fileRef = D5F05D451BB52078003AE55E /* duplicateJson */; };
6163
D5F05D481BB520B1003AE55E /* FilesTests.swift in Sources */ = {isa = PBXBuildFile; fileRef = D5F05D471BB520B1003AE55E /* FilesTests.swift */; };
6264
D5FAD9091B63B05700ECE230 /* Images.xcassets in Resources */ = {isa = PBXBuildFile; fileRef = D55C6CC61B5D757300301B0D /* Images.xcassets */; };
65+
D80B9E2AC049322EF7FFB2BA /* Pods_Shared_ResourceApp.framework in Frameworks */ = {isa = PBXBuildFile; fileRef = BA2177EF715BB7F766BD6216 /* Pods_Shared_ResourceApp.framework */; };
6366
DEF5599A1CA4873D009B8C51 /* AppDelegate.swift in Sources */ = {isa = PBXBuildFile; fileRef = DEF559991CA4873D009B8C51 /* AppDelegate.swift */; };
6467
DEF5599F1CA4873D009B8C51 /* Main.storyboard in Resources */ = {isa = PBXBuildFile; fileRef = DEF5599D1CA4873D009B8C51 /* Main.storyboard */; };
6568
DEF559A11CA4873D009B8C51 /* Assets.xcassets in Resources */ = {isa = PBXBuildFile; fileRef = DEF559A01CA4873D009B8C51 /* Assets.xcassets */; };
@@ -111,6 +114,7 @@
111114
5D9E41331C96918E002172D3 /* StringsTests.swift */ = {isa = PBXFileReference; fileEncoding = 4; lastKnownFileType = sourcecode.swift; path = StringsTests.swift; sourceTree = "<group>"; };
112115
70B4C9EF7848D510D018EB8E /* Pods-Shared-ResourceApp-tvOS.debug.xcconfig */ = {isa = PBXFileReference; includeInIndex = 1; lastKnownFileType = text.xcconfig; name = "Pods-Shared-ResourceApp-tvOS.debug.xcconfig"; path = "../Pods/Target Support Files/Pods-Shared-ResourceApp-tvOS/Pods-Shared-ResourceApp-tvOS.debug.xcconfig"; sourceTree = "<group>"; };
113116
9C2D4D874D7A6B1F02578293 /* Pods-Shared-ResourceAppTests.release.xcconfig */ = {isa = PBXFileReference; includeInIndex = 1; lastKnownFileType = text.xcconfig; name = "Pods-Shared-ResourceAppTests.release.xcconfig"; path = "../Pods/Target Support Files/Pods-Shared-ResourceAppTests/Pods-Shared-ResourceAppTests.release.xcconfig"; sourceTree = "<group>"; };
117+
BA2177EF715BB7F766BD6216 /* Pods_Shared_ResourceApp.framework */ = {isa = PBXFileReference; explicitFileType = wrapper.framework; includeInIndex = 0; path = Pods_Shared_ResourceApp.framework; sourceTree = BUILT_PRODUCTS_DIR; };
114118
C378DD791C68C2BF003598B8 /* SupplementaryElement.xib */ = {isa = PBXFileReference; fileEncoding = 4; lastKnownFileType = file.xib; path = SupplementaryElement.xib; sourceTree = "<group>"; };
115119
D41BDD927A1804A5D763C750 /* Pods-Shared-ResourceApp-tvOS.release.xcconfig */ = {isa = PBXFileReference; includeInIndex = 1; lastKnownFileType = text.xcconfig; name = "Pods-Shared-ResourceApp-tvOS.release.xcconfig"; path = "../Pods/Target Support Files/Pods-Shared-ResourceApp-tvOS/Pods-Shared-ResourceApp-tvOS.release.xcconfig"; sourceTree = "<group>"; };
116120
D436146321CC7322E5ECEE24 /* Pods-Shared-ResourceAppTests.debug.xcconfig */ = {isa = PBXFileReference; includeInIndex = 1; lastKnownFileType = text.xcconfig; name = "Pods-Shared-ResourceAppTests.debug.xcconfig"; path = "../Pods/Target Support Files/Pods-Shared-ResourceAppTests/Pods-Shared-ResourceAppTests.debug.xcconfig"; sourceTree = "<group>"; };
@@ -177,6 +181,7 @@
177181
DEF559AD1CA48892009B8C51 /* ResourceAppTests_tvOS.swift */ = {isa = PBXFileReference; lastKnownFileType = sourcecode.swift; path = ResourceAppTests_tvOS.swift; sourceTree = "<group>"; };
178182
DEF559AF1CA48892009B8C51 /* Info.plist */ = {isa = PBXFileReference; lastKnownFileType = text.plist.xml; path = Info.plist; sourceTree = "<group>"; };
179183
DEF559B61CA48DC2009B8C51 /* R.generated.swift */ = {isa = PBXFileReference; fileEncoding = 4; lastKnownFileType = sourcecode.swift; lineEnding = 0; path = R.generated.swift; sourceTree = "<group>"; xcLanguageSpecificationIdentifier = xcode.lang.swift; };
184+
E1B2B4287A3B52DAB3098AA2 /* Pods_Shared_ResourceAppTests.framework */ = {isa = PBXFileReference; explicitFileType = wrapper.framework; includeInIndex = 0; path = Pods_Shared_ResourceAppTests.framework; sourceTree = BUILT_PRODUCTS_DIR; };
180185
E20983231D585E78005ACBAA /* SegueTests.swift */ = {isa = PBXFileReference; fileEncoding = 4; lastKnownFileType = sourcecode.swift; path = SegueTests.swift; sourceTree = "<group>"; };
181186
E20983251D585F8C005ACBAA /* Xib with ViewController.xib */ = {isa = PBXFileReference; fileEncoding = 4; lastKnownFileType = file.xib; path = "Xib with ViewController.xib"; sourceTree = "<group>"; };
182187
E2156B641CC4042900F341DC /* Base */ = {isa = PBXFileReference; lastKnownFileType = text.plist.strings; name = Base; path = Base.lproj/Settings.strings; sourceTree = "<group>"; };
@@ -199,27 +204,31 @@
199204
E2CD68651D7CACCA00BEBE59 /* es */ = {isa = PBXFileReference; lastKnownFileType = text; name = es; path = es.lproj/hello.txt; sourceTree = "<group>"; };
200205
E2CD68661D7CACCB00BEBE59 /* nl */ = {isa = PBXFileReference; lastKnownFileType = text; name = nl; path = nl.lproj/hello.txt; sourceTree = "<group>"; };
201206
E2F268B01C92BFE00093995D /* My R.swift colors.clr */ = {isa = PBXFileReference; lastKnownFileType = file; path = "My R.swift colors.clr"; sourceTree = "<group>"; };
207+
EF513940333862726B930435 /* Pods_Shared_ResourceApp_tvOS.framework */ = {isa = PBXFileReference; explicitFileType = wrapper.framework; includeInIndex = 0; path = Pods_Shared_ResourceApp_tvOS.framework; sourceTree = BUILT_PRODUCTS_DIR; };
202208
/* End PBXFileReference section */
203209

204210
/* Begin PBXFrameworksBuildPhase section */
205211
D55C6CB51B5D757300301B0D /* Frameworks */ = {
206212
isa = PBXFrameworksBuildPhase;
207213
buildActionMask = 2147483647;
208214
files = (
215+
D80B9E2AC049322EF7FFB2BA /* Pods_Shared_ResourceApp.framework in Frameworks */,
209216
);
210217
runOnlyForDeploymentPostprocessing = 0;
211218
};
212219
D55C6CCC1B5D757300301B0D /* Frameworks */ = {
213220
isa = PBXFrameworksBuildPhase;
214221
buildActionMask = 2147483647;
215222
files = (
223+
B9AD30832913E120484BAD10 /* Pods_Shared_ResourceAppTests.framework in Frameworks */,
216224
);
217225
runOnlyForDeploymentPostprocessing = 0;
218226
};
219227
DEF559941CA4873D009B8C51 /* Frameworks */ = {
220228
isa = PBXFrameworksBuildPhase;
221229
buildActionMask = 2147483647;
222230
files = (
231+
8A0FBCE6E8FF0950B8821B0B /* Pods_Shared_ResourceApp_tvOS.framework in Frameworks */,
223232
);
224233
runOnlyForDeploymentPostprocessing = 0;
225234
};
@@ -237,6 +246,9 @@
237246
isa = PBXGroup;
238247
children = (
239248
D5B799881C1B8F0C009EA901 /* AVKit.framework */,
249+
BA2177EF715BB7F766BD6216 /* Pods_Shared_ResourceApp.framework */,
250+
EF513940333862726B930435 /* Pods_Shared_ResourceApp_tvOS.framework */,
251+
E1B2B4287A3B52DAB3098AA2 /* Pods_Shared_ResourceAppTests.framework */,
240252
);
241253
name = Frameworks;
242254
sourceTree = "<group>";

Sources/rswift/Rswift.swift

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-10,6 +10,6 @@
1010
import Foundation
1111

1212
struct Rswift {
13-
static let version = "3.9.0"
13+
static let version = "3.3.0.beta.1"
1414
static let resourceFileName = "R.generated.swift"
1515
}

0 commit comments

Comments
 (0)